We arrive this coming Saturday. In the past, we used to drive to Grand Case a couple of evenings for dinner. How is that drive now? The street lights were not the best pre Irma. Have they been restored? We always parked in the pay lot which was really just a field. Is it open and has it been cleared of Irma debris? Would have to end up with flat tires after dinner.

We stayed in Grand Case in October, so didn't do anything but local driving at night, so can't answer your streetlight question. The pay lot appeared to be open some, but not every night, as it was quite low key there in Oct. We never parked in that lot, but did park in the free lot. There was also parking on the street as most of the businesses on the ocean side are no longer open.
